Finance Review Summary — Hedging Decision

Reviewed Q3 exposure on the Velran crown following the Osterfeld expansion. Forward contracts locked for 70% of projected receivables; remainder floats per Tavrin's model. Cost of carry acceptable; downside capped at tolerance threshold. No objections from treasury. Decision stands through year-end unless volatility doubles. The strategic rationale behind the partial hedge is noted below.

confidential, bahop-hahif: Only 3 of the 140 pilot accounts renewed Oliath, so a churn review is set for July 15.

## Sweeper Limits and Quotas

The Tidewatch sweeper scans Corvale Cloud accounts for orphaned volumes, snapshots, and load balancers left behind after project deletion. To avoid impacting live workloads, it enforces strict per-account scan quotas and a deletion rate ceiling; exceeding either pauses the sweep and opens a review ticket. Support should quote these limits when customers ask why cleanup appears slow. The enforced values are defined as follows.

tuning table, kajog-kawef:
PRIORITIES = {
    "kelox": 870,
    "kasix": 89,
    "eliax": 988,
}

Subject: Quickstore 4.2 — bloom filter now fronts the KV layer

Plugin authors: starting with this release, Quickstore places a bloom filter ahead of the key-value store. Negative lookups return faster; false positives fall through safely. No API changes are required on your side. Verify your plugin against the staging build referenced below.

session token of fahif-tadup = htk3_9c7

TICKET LOC-914: Datesmith staging showing US-style dates for every locale. Turns out the env was missing the locale service credential, so the formatter silently fell back to en-US defaults. Fun. For future maintainers: the fallback should probably be loud, but that's a separate ticket. For now, the fix is just giving staging the credential. Add this line to the staging env file:

env line for fafof-fahag: LEDGER_TOKEN5=f8790